About the company:

Fyto’s mission is to help farmers accelerate and profit from the transition to a more sustainable food system. We partner with farmers to build a regenerative, scalable and modular platform for food, feed and fertilizer. Our patented system is built with remote sensing, state-of-the-art computer vision, and real-time reporting that enables automated harvests, every day of the year. Learn more about us at fyto.us.

About FYTO

At Fyto, we are partnering with farmers to build a sustainable food system at a global scale. Since launching out of MIT in 2019, we have developed an innovative robotics platform that grows ultra-efficient, nutritious aquatic plants to feed people, plants, and animals. Our systems use much less energy, water, land, labor, and fertilizer than conventional approaches. Want to grow with us? We believe in helping you apply your talents in new and impactful ways. About the Role

Fyto is commercializing nutritious aquatic plant production at scale and we’re looking for a Director of Animal Nutrition and Regulatory Affairs to drive our animal science and maintain our regulatory progress as we prepare to launch first products into California’s dairy feed market and beyond.

Developing and implementing regulatory strategies and managing regulatory submissions to ensure products are approved in a timely manner will be key for success in this role. Overseeing ruminant nutrition will require flexible leadership in areas such as directing 3rd party feed trials, working with animal nutritionists on ration formulations, collaborating with industry and academic leaders, providing technical sales support, and other various duties focused on dairy producer satisfaction.

You'll bring a deep technical understanding of livestock nutrition along with extensive experience navigating state and federal regulation for new agricultural products. You’ll also have a passion for introducing novel products that help farmers accelerate, and profit from, the transition towards a more sustainable food system. If successful, Fyto could positively transform our global food system - your work will be instrumental in achieving this vision.

This position can be remote or based at Fyto Headquarters in Petaluma, CA. Some travel (estimated 10-20%) throughout California (primarily in San Joaquin Valley) and beyond will be required. Candidates must be authorized to work in the United States and are subject to a background check.

What you’ll do

  • Responsible for the development, implementation, maintenance, and overall success of Fyto's global regulatory and nutrition programs and strategies, with an initial focus on the commercialization of novel dairy feed in California.
  • Oversee preparation and submission of regulatory documentation. Communicate with agencies (e.g. CDFA, FDA, AAFCO) about pre-submission strategies, potential regulatory pathways, and follow up of submissions under review. Ensure compliance with all regulations and statutes during the development and sale of Fyto’s products.
  • Organize all relevant product information to ensure ingredients, formulations, and claims are in compliance with state and federal regulations. Review and approve regulatory impact resulting from product or process changes.
  • Collaborate with the Commercial, Plant Science, Engineering, and Operations teams to ensure their work enables, and is compliant with, Fyto’s overall regulatory objectives.
  • Direct Fyto’s ongoing dairy feed trials and future ruminant research initiatives.
  • Apply working knowledge of commercial livestock production to direct the creation and support the sale of differentiated animal feed products. Win the trust and loyalty of producers by providing practical dairy nutrition recommendations and solutions.
  • Collaborate with nutritionists, animal scientists, and veterinarians to troubleshoot complex, on-farm nutrition challenges.
  • Engage established networks within related organizations including trade associations, agencies, and consultants to advance Fyto’s research and commercial objectives.
